Denise and Kirk Daniels graciously welcome you to dine at one of the Lakes Region's most treasured restaurants. Experience the charm of an authentic 19th-century farmhouse and barn tucked away along quaint country roads and surrounded by open pastures, orchards and mountain vistas. The restaurant's rustic decor, coupled with warm and gracious service and award winning cuisine, has won the Woodshed a reputation as the place to dine for special occasions.
